Hi Shawna-

They cost $900 and up, depending on what you want (tooling, skirting, silver 
etc etc). Mine were $1200 (nice show saddle, used one year) and $1600 (deluxe 
trail model, tried on the horse but never used, with custom-fit SKito pad). 
You guessed it, I was too impatient for the custom made saddle so bought 
used! 

The distributor on the sportsaddle.com site is very professional and helpful. 
It's recommended you send her photos and a description of your horse's shape, 
as a number of things can be altered to ensure a good fit.
